Imaginary Landscape No.2 (March)



Category: Musical composition
Dated: Chicago, April 1942
Instrumentation: Percussion quintet (originally: For percussion orchestra (5 players))
Duration: 7'
Premiere and performer(s): San Francisco, performed by an ensemble conducted by Lou Harrison
Dedicated to: Lou Harrison
Choreography: ---
Published: Edition Peters 6721 © 1960 by Henmar Press
Manuscript: Score (holograph - photocopy with holographic annotation in ink - 21 p.); Score (holograph in pencil - 21 p.); Directions to copyist concerning publication (typescript, with manuscript in pencil in an unidentified hand - 1 lf.); Parts (galley proffs with corrections by John Cage in blue pencil - 6+4+5+4+3 p.); Score (galley proofs with corrections by John Cage in blue pencil - 16 p.) all in New York Public Library.


The rhythmic structure is 3, 4, 2, 3, 5. The percussion instruments used are combined with an amplified coil of wire, attached to a phonographic tone arm. The instruments are tin cans, conch shell, ratchet, bass drum, buzzers, water gong, metal wastebasket and lion's roar.
